What companies run services between Bucharest, Romania and Baja, Bács-Kiskun County, Hungary?

You can take a train from Bucuresti Nord to Baja via Budapest-Keleti and Sarbogard in around 21h 3m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from București, Autogara Militari to Baja, autóbusz-állomás via Szeged, autóbusz-állomás in around 14h 55m.
